§ 19a-288 — (Formerly Sec. 19-145). Delivering or receiving corpse for speculation; penalty.

Text

Any person who delivers or receives a corpse for the purpose of speculation or pecuniary profit shall be fined not more than one thousand dollars and imprisoned not more than one year.

Legislative History

(1949 Rev., S. 4221.) History: Sec. 19-145 transferred to Sec. 19a-288 in 1983.
